There was a goddess for harvest called (Renenet) who the celebrations were held for her during the harvest. In contrast, after the construction of the High Dam, Egypt cultivates according to summer and winter seasons as there are summer crops and winter crops.

This can be noticed in different tombs such as Teti and Nefertari tombs opened for the public. The design of these tombs begins with a small antechamber, a long narrow corridor with several side chambers, then the burial chamber at the end of the tomb.

It was happening on February 21nd and October 21nd, but after the transferring of these temples by UNESCO, this phenomenon became occurring on February 22nd and October 22nd. The sun rays reach the Holy of Holies of Abu Simbel temple that has four statues.

8) Museum of Islamic Art in Cairo Museum of Islamic Art is the largest museum in the whole world that displays Islamic Art collections. It holds about a hundred thousand objects that came from different countries such as India, China, and North Africa to Andalusia.

The church is dedicated to Sergius and Bacchus, who were soldier-saints martyred during the 4th century in Syria by the Roman Emperor Maximian. The Coptic Museum The Coptic Museum opened in 1910 and houses the world's largest collection of Coptic artifacts.
